Manufacturing Engineering Manager Green Card Jobs
Manufacturing Engineering Manager roles qualify for employment-based green card sponsorship under EB-2 or EB-3, depending on your degree level and credentials. Employers file PERM labor certification with DOL before sponsoring your I-140 petition, making this a path to permanent U.S. residency rather than a temporary status.

Get Access To All JobsTips for Finding Green Card Sponsorship as a Manufacturing Engineering Manager
Align your credentials with PERM requirements
PERM requires your education and experience to match the employer's stated minimum requirements exactly. Get foreign degrees evaluated by a NACES-member credential evaluator before applying, since mismatches between your transcript and the job posting can derail the labor certification stage.
Target manufacturers with established immigration infrastructure
Automotive, aerospace, and semiconductor manufacturers run recurring PERM filings for engineering management roles. Search DOL OFLC disclosure data to identify which employers have filed labor certifications for Manufacturing Engineering Manager or similar SOC-coded positions in your target region.
Benchmark your salary against OFLC prevailing wages
PERM requires your offered wage to meet or exceed the DOL prevailing wage for your job zone and location. Use the OFLC Wage Search to confirm the Level II or Level III wage floor before evaluating any offer, since employers can't reduce the wage after filing.
Clarify sponsorship intent before the offer stage
Ask directly during late-round interviews whether the company has an established PERM process for this role classification. Manufacturing firms sometimes sponsor H-1B transfers but stop short of green card sponsorship, so confirming the full pathway early avoids wasted time.

Understand concurrent filing if your priority date is current
For EB-3 filers from most countries, USCIS allows you to file I-140 and I-485 concurrently once a visa number is available. This can shorten your wait for permanent residency significantly compared to waiting for each step sequentially after PERM certification.

Find Manufacturing Engineering Manager JobsManufacturing Engineering Manager Green Card Sponsorship: Frequently Asked Questions
Does a Manufacturing Engineering Manager role qualify for EB-2 or EB-3 green card sponsorship?
It depends on how the employer defines the minimum requirements for the position. If the role requires a master's degree or a bachelor's degree plus five years of progressive experience, it typically qualifies under EB-2. Roles requiring a bachelor's degree with standard experience fall under EB-3. Your employer's PERM attorney will structure the job description to match the correct preference category based on your actual credentials.
How does green card sponsorship differ from H-1B sponsorship for this role?
H-1B is a temporary nonimmigrant status capped at 85,000 annually with a lottery, while EB-2 and EB-3 green card sponsorship leads to permanent residency with no annual lottery. The PERM process adds a DOL-supervised labor market test before your I-140 can be filed, making the overall timeline longer, but the outcome is lawful permanent residency rather than a visa requiring periodic renewal.
How long does the PERM and green card process take for Manufacturing Engineering Manager roles?
The PERM labor certification stage alone takes six to twelve months under standard processing, plus additional time if DOL selects the case for audit. After PERM certification, I-140 adjudication adds several more months. For applicants from countries without a backlog, the full process from PERM filing to green card approval commonly runs two to four years, though country of birth significantly affects final wait times.

Can I switch employers during the green card process without losing my place in line?
Once your I-140 is approved and your priority date is more than 180 days old, portability rules under AC21 allow you to change to a same or similar occupational classification without losing your priority date. Manufacturing Engineering Manager roles share SOC codes with related engineering management titles, so a lateral move to a comparable role at a new employer typically preserves your place in the queue.
